Decoding the Modern B2B Sales Landscape: Challenges and Digital Demands

Today's B2B buyers are more informed, discerning, and self-sufficient than ever before. They conduct extensive research online, often completing up to 70% of their buying journey before ever speaking to a sales representative. This means that when a sales rep does finally engage, they need to add significant value, demonstrating deep understanding and offering solutions tailored precisely to the buyer's unique challenges. The proliferation of digital channels—from social media to industry forums—has made it both easier and harder to connect, simultaneously creating more touchpoints while also increasing the noise sales professionals must cut through.

Sales teams, on their part, face immense pressure. They're expected to be consultative experts, master communicators, data analysts, and administrative wizards all at once. The demands include: * Declining Sales Productivity: As noted, reps spend less time selling. Manual tasks like prospecting, data entry, and content searching eat into valuable selling hours. * Inconsistent Messaging: Without centralized, intelligent content management, sales reps might use outdated or off-brand materials, leading to disjointed customer experiences. * Lack of Personalized Engagement: Generic outreach and one-size-fits-all presentations fail to resonate with sophisticated B2B buyers who expect highly relevant, timely interactions. * Ineffective Training and Coaching: Traditional methods often struggle to provide real-time, personalized feedback, leaving reps with skill gaps that impact performance. * Complex Sales Cycles: B2B sales often involve multiple stakeholders, intricate decision-making processes, and lengthy timelines, requiring precise orchestration and follow-up.

These challenges highlight a critical need for systems that can empower sales teams to be more strategic, data-driven, and customer-centric. This is where the transformative power of AI sales enablement B2B truly shines.

Building Your AI Sales Enablement Framework: A Step-by-Step Guide

Embarking on an AI sales enablement B2B initiative can seem daunting, but a structured approach mitigates risks and maximizes ROI.

Here’s a practical framework:

  1. Define Clear Objectives and KPIs:

    • What problem are you trying to solve? Is it low conversion rates, long sales cycles, inconsistent messaging, or rep productivity?
    • What does success look like? Define measurable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) such as improved lead-to-opportunity conversion, reduced sales cycle length, increased average deal size, higher rep quota attainment, or improved content engagement.
    • Example: "Increase MQL to SQL conversion by 15% within 12 months using AI-powered lead scoring and personalized outreach."
  2. Assess Current State and Identify Gaps:

    • Audit existing sales processes, tools, and content. Where are the manual bottlenecks? What data is currently underutilized?
    • Evaluate your existing tech stack. What CRM (e.g., Salesforce, HubSpot), marketing automation, and sales engagement platforms do you use? How well do they integrate?
    • Understand your data readiness. Do you have clean, consistent data to feed AI models? Data quality is paramount.
  3. Pilot Program and Phased Implementation:

    • Start small. Choose one specific area to pilot AI (e.g., AI-driven content recommendations for a specific product line or AI-powered call coaching for a small team).
    • Select the right tools. Research and choose AI tools that align with your objectives, integrate with your existing systems, and offer strong support. Consider platforms like Outreach.io for sales engagement, Drift for conversational AI, or ZoomInfo for intent data.
    • Gather feedback and iterate. Use the pilot to understand challenges, measure initial impact, and refine your approach before a broader rollout.
  4. Integration and Data Flow:

    • Ensure seamless integration between your CRM, sales engagement platform, content management system, and any new AI tools. A unified data view is crucial.
    • Establish robust data pipelines to ensure AI models receive up-to-date, accurate information. This includes historical sales data, customer interactions, marketing analytics, and external market data.
  5. Training and Adoption:

    • Invest in comprehensive training for your sales and marketing teams. Emphasize how AI will help them, not replace them.
    • Create champions. Identify early adopters within your sales team who can advocate for the new tools and share best practices.
    • Foster a culture of experimentation and learning. Encourage reps to provide feedback and actively use the AI tools.
  6. Measure, Analyze, and Optimize:

    • Continuously monitor KPIs and analyze the impact of AI on sales performance.
    • Use AI to analyze its own effectiveness. For example, AI can identify which recommended content pieces led to higher engagement or which coaching suggestions resulted in improved call metrics.
    • Regularly review and update your AI strategies and tools as market conditions and technological capabilities evolve.
